Deepbluediver May 30, 2024 @ 2:10am 
First, reports from stacks don't count multiple- you need to be reported by different people in different matches for it to have any effect.

Second, trying to jungle from level 1 is a dumb strategy. Valve worked hard to kill it off, and yes people will report you because it pointlessly puts your entire team at a disadvantage.
Learn to lane.

Jungling was a viable strategy about 3-4 years ago, but it got nerfed over the years - all the cool items that made it easier got nerfed or straight deleted, and most importantly creep lifesteal in particular has been nerfed to be very weak to the point that it basically doesn't outheal the creep damage on most heroes.

You can't jungle at Level 1. You must lane at least for a bit, acquire Mask of Madness, Armlet of Mordigan, something among those lines, THEN you can go to the forest and even then its an inferior idea and you should only be doing it if the lane is f*cked.

It's not that the game is "the best thing to do is exploit all the resources" so much as "how do you BEST exploit the available resources?" The difference is small but crucial.

If you go to the jungle from level 1, you will be behind because jungle-farm is slower than lane farm. And the person in lane will also be behind because they will get zoned out and the enemy will free farm. So even though you're TRYING to exploit a greater number of creeps, even if you both do as well as you possibly can you'll be behind the enemy lane in XP and gold because your effectiveness is so diminished. In other words, trying to jungle from level 1 is basically the same as a guarantee that you lose the laning-phase competition.

Anyway, go watch high level matches- with RARE exceptions, almost no one ever sits in the jungle for any significant amount of time (and definitely not at level 1). They stop to farm a creep camp or 2 to pick up the neutral items quickly, or on their way to do something else.
How much farm you, personally, have is less important than the RELATIVE amount of farm between your team and the enemy team. This is a key point in learning to play DotA well- getting over your own self-interest.

Jungling is a trap- it FEELS like safe farm, but what you don't realize is that every minute you spend there you are falling behind where you could be if you were doing more to help your team.
